Penerapan Metode Tilawati Dalam Pembelajaran Al-Qur’an Di Pondok Pesantren Hidayatul Mubtadi’ien Kota Bengkulu Rosyid, Muhammad Agus Ainur; Alimni, Alimni
AHDÃF: Jurnal Pendidikan Agama Islam Vol. 2 No. 2 (2024): AHDAF: Jurnal Pendidikan Agama Islam

Abstract

This study aims to analyse the planning, implementation, and evaluation of the application of the Tilawati method at Hidayatul Mubtadi'ien Islamic Boarding School, as well as identify the supporting and inhibiting factors. The research method employed is a descriptive qualitative approach, utilizing data collection techniques that include in-depth interviews, observation, and documentation studies. The results showed that the planning of the application of the Tilawati method involved selecting teaching staff with syahādah, preparing learning objectives based on the stages of the students' abilities, and providing media and teaching materials, such as the Kitab Tilawati Volumes 1-6. The implementation of this method combines classical and individual approaches, which have proven effective in improving the ability to read the Qur'an. The main obstacles identified include santri discipline and difficulty in reciting Rost, while supporting factors include the quality of teaching staff, infrastructure, and institutional support. Strategic solutions, such as intensive training, rescheduling sleeping habits, and utilizing the Tilawati Mobile application, successfully overcame the obstacles. This study has implications for the development of technology-based Qur'an learning methods and holistic approaches to improve the quality of education in pesantren.
Health Risk Assessment of Hydrogen Sulfide (H₂S) Exposure Among Communities Near a Bioethanol Industry: A Case Study from Mojokerto, Indonesia Fatmalia, Nabila; Khambali, Khambali; Sulistio, Irwan; Rachmania; Rosyid, Muhammad Agus Ainur; Amin, Muhammad
Jurnal Higiene Sanitasi Vol. 5 No. 1 (2025)

Abstract

The community of Gempolkerep village still smells an unpleasant odour indicated by the presence of H₂S gas in the bioethanol plant. Due to the unpleasant and pungent odour, people in Gempolkerep village experience complaints such as sore eyes, sneezing, coughing, sore throat, shortness of breath, and dizziness. This study aims to determine the effect of H₂S gas exposure on subjective complaints of the community around the bioethanol plant. This research is a quantitative research with a cross-sectional design. The population in this study were housewives of Gempolkerep village of 940 people and measurement of H₂S gas levels in ambient air in Gempolkerep village, Mojokerto district. The sample in this study was taken from a portion of the population with a sample size of 273 respondents. The sampling technique used in this study was purposive sampling method. Data analysis using chi-square statistical test. The results showed that the average measurement of hydrogen sulfide gas levels at the first point was 28.3 µg/Nm3 and at the second point was 15 µg/Nm3. The variables of age, length of exposure, and exposure distance have a significant relationship to subjective complaints with a value of (p-value = 0.000), (p-value = 0.008), and (p-value = 0.001) to the subjective complaints of the people of Gempolkerep Village, but there is no influence of medical history on the subjective complaints of the people of Gempolkerep Village in 2024. The conclusion of this study is that H₂S levels do not affect subjective complaints in the people of Gempolkerep Village in 2024. The advice given to the community is that they can plant ylang-ylang trees, which help reduce the level of pollutants in the air. In addition, the community must be able to maintain immunity by adopting a healthy lifestyle, eating nutritious foods, protecting the environment, and conducting regular health checks.
